How they compare
Hungary currently reports 1.65 against 1.63 in Korea, a difference of 0.02.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 65 shared years of data; in 1960 it was Korea ahead.
Hungary ranks 168th and Korea ranks 171st of 200 countries.
Across the 7 decades both report, Hungary averaged higher in 3 and Korea in 4.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Hungary | Korea |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 18.77 | 64.08 | 45.31 | Korea |
| 1970s | 9.35 | 27.83 | 18.48 | Korea |
| 1980s | 6.58 | 13.75 | 7.18 | Korea |
| 1990s | 5.29 | 6.04 | 0.7532 | Korea |
| 2000s | 3.5 | 3.3 | 0.1964 | Hungary |
| 2010s | 2.35 | 1.96 | 0.3876 | Hungary |
| 2020s | 1.75 | 1.66 | 0.0903 | Hungary |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
